RSGB Trophies

Here is information on the trophies which the RSGB award:

Awarded by National Council:

Katie Filmer, M3XPO, winner of the G5RP trophyBennett Prize
For any significant contribution or innovation which furthers the art of radio communication

Calcutta Key
For work associated with international friendship through amateur radio

Founder's Trophy
For outstanding service to the Society

Raynet Trophy
For outstanding service to the Radio Amateurs' Emergency Network

Horace Freeman
Winner of Home Constructors' Competition at RSGB National Convention

Kenwood Trophy
For making a significant contribution to training and development in amateur radio within the United Kingdom

Awarded by the EMC Committee:

G5RV Trophy
For outstanding contributions in the EMC field

Awarded by the Technical Committee:

Courtney-Price Trophy
For the most outstanding published technical contribution to amateur radio

Ostermeyer Trophy
For most meritorious description of a piece of home-constructed or electronic equipment published in RadCom

Norman Keith Adarns Prize
For the most original article published in RadCom

Wortley-Talbot Trophy
For outstanding experimental work in amateur radio

Awarded by the Spectrum Forum (VHF Manager):

Harold Rose Trophy
To the person making an outstanding contribution to 50MHz

Louis Varney Cup
For advances in space communication

1962 Committee Cup
Awarded at VHF Convention for the best home constructed equipment
